Alberto B. Aldaco Sr., 68, passed away September 2, 2023, in a Pasadena, Texas hospital after a short illness. He was preceded in death by his parents: Margarita Gonzales and Jose Abel Mungia Aldaco Sr. (Florencia), his brothers: Jose M. “Joey” Aldaco Jr.,, Enrique Flores; his sisters: Gloria Flores and Sally Jo Flores.
Anyone who knew our dad knew he was such a jokester! Never a dull moment when he was around, that’s for sure! One thing he loved to do was to sing and play the acoustic guitar! Some of his most favorites to sing and play were Rose Colored Glasses, Stairway to Heaven, On the Road Again, Lucille, and Elvira. As children, that was one thing we loved. He was always making people laugh by cracking jokes, or singing, and he loved his Cheetos Puffs and chocolate!
Survivors include his children: Amy J. Aldaco-Freeman (Janell) of Walker, LA, Christina M. Aldaco- Dilan (Ismael) of Houston, TX, Alberto B. Aldaco Jr. (Fran) of Spring, TX, Christopher L. Aldaco (Crystal) of Pasadena, TX, 12 grandchildren, 18 great-grandchildren, and numerous nieces and nephews.
Also surviving, brothers: Jose “Tino” Aldaco Jr., Miguel “Mike” Aldaco of Grapevine, TX, Andres “Taco Bell” Aldaco, Jessie “Negro” Aldaco of Fort Worth, TX, and Tony Aldaco of Oklahoma City, OK.; Joseph Flores Jr.three sisters: Jesusa Pina of Alice, Texas, Aracelia Herrera of Dallas, Texas, and Amalia Vasquez of Grapevine, Texas.
Special thanks to our father’s niece and nephews: Letty, Jose, Jaime, Fransico, and Ricardo Aldaco.
His body will be laid to rest next to his beloved brother, Jose aka “Joey”, at the Saint Louis Cemetery in Custar, Ohio.
